Introduction of the TCF Test The TCF is developed by the French Ministry of Education and is commonly recognized by organizations and organizations that need proof of French language proficiency. The test assesses candidates in a number of areas, including listening comprehension, reading understanding, spoken expression, and composed expression.

How to Register Online for the TCF Test The online registration process for the TCF test typically follows a series of straightforward steps. Here is a comprehensive guide:
Step-by-Step Registration Process Pick the Right Platform: The initial step is to visit the official site of the company administering the TCF test in your area, such as France Education International (FEI) or your local French cultural center.
Select Your Test Date: Review the available test dates and select one that finest fits your schedule.
Develop an Account: If you are a novice registrant, create an account on the platform. You will need to provide individual details, such as your name, date of birth, email address, and potentially your nationality.
Complete the Registration Form: Fill in the registration kind with the required information, including your selected test center, test date, and any special lodgings you might need.
Publish Identification Documents: Most registration platforms will need you to publish a valid recognition file (passport, national ID, and so on). Guarantee the document is clear and clear.
Payment: Proceed to the payment area. The costs for the TCF test might differ by area and organization, so be prepared to pay online through credit/debit card or other accepted payment approaches.
Confirmation: After finishing the payment, you will receive a confirmation email with your registration details. Keep this email for your records.
Prepare for the Test: Utilize the time before your test date to study and practice. Numerous platforms use official practice products, sample questions, and suggestions for success.

Language Proficiency Level: Understand which level of TCF you need to take based upon your goals (e.g., scholastic requirements, work applications).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) 1. What is the expense of the TCF test? The cost varies by place and test center. On average, fees v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 200. Inspect the particular website for precise rates.
2. The length of time does it require to get test results? Results are typically available within 2 to 4 weeks after the test date. Prospects will receive a certificate that details their ratings and proficiency level.
3. Can I change my test date after registration? Many test centers permit prospects to alter their test dates, but it typically comes with a cost. Check the particular policies of your testing center.
4. What files do I require for registration? You will typically require a legitimate ID (passport or national ID) and perhaps extra documents depending upon your location.
5. Is the TCF test offered online? While the registration procedure is online, the TCF test itself is normally carried out in-person at authorized testing centers.
